What is Project Pilates?
Project Pilates, established in 2006, is a dedicated studio in Jersey City focused on providing individualized Pilates instruction to improve strength, mobility, and long-term wellness. The company offers a range of services, including small equipment classes (limited to six participants), private sessions, and semi-private sessions, all meticulously tailored to client requirements. Their approach emphasizes core stability and balanced muscle development, guided by experienced instructors in a supportive learning environment. Positioned conveniently near public transportation, Project Pilates champions a low-impact, full-body exercise methodology designed for overall health enhancement and injury prevention.
How much funding has Project Pilates raised?
Project Pilates has raised a total of $35K across 1 funding round:
Debt
$35K
Debt (2021): $35K with participation from PPP
